What are the Bus Classes & Prices of Kriangkai Transport?

The price of your bus trip will depend both on the destination and the class of your ticket. Note that not all ticket classes are available on certain routes yet for longer trips there is almost always a good choice of options. Opt for a sleeper coach for the most convenient overnight trip. Sleeper buses are usually equipped with berths or soft reclining seats, feature an onboard toilet and your ticket may also include other perks like snacks or even a lunch. Taking a night bus is also a good idea if you want to save on your hotel room. During the day an express service is often the best value for money as it makes less stops than an ordinary or standard class bus and travels faster. On some routes it may be crucial to choose the right class as, say, an ordinary or second class bus may need some 6 hours to cover the distance the first class or express bus travels in two hours!

Pros & Cons of Bus Travel

Pros of Bus Travel

  • Buses usually boast the widest network of destinations covered. They travel to the places you cannot get to by plane or even by train

  • Travelling by bus is easy – there is no need to arrive to the bus terminal much in advance, and the check-in is usually a very fast formality opposite to air travel

  • Bus tickets are very affordable. Yes, there are costly first class or VIP options but is you are on a budget, bus is the first means of transportation you have to think about

  • At the same time, there are different classes of service to suit any budget. If you are after a higher level of comfort, buses get you covered, too.

Cons of Bus Travel

  • Intercity bus terminals can be located outside the city centre in the outskirts. It means you will need to calculate extra time and money to get there. In certain destinations getting from the bus terminal can cost you more than you would expect because only a limited number of transportation companies is allowed to serve the route – and prices may be inflated.

  • During busy weekends or high season buses serving some tourist destinations may run out of schedule and require advanced booking.

  • While buses are not as weather dependent as ferries, bus trips can also be delayed or cancelled due to bad weather or road conditions – keep it in mind if travelling during certain seasons or to certain destinations.

C B
Be aware that it is a very, very bumpy ride! We barely slept. The bus itself is quite good. If you travel alone, be aware you share a small bed with a stranger. There are charging stations, but they didn't work, so make sure you have everything fully charged. The staff onboard doesn't speak English. Our bus was very empty, but we weren't allowed to sleep on another bed, so we had to stay together on the same bed. Also, the bus has a toilet onboard, so no stops. Make sure you've had dinner before getting onboard. You get a small bottle of water from the staff.

S
The bus left on time and arrived on time so no complaints. The beds are clean enough and blankets, pillow and water are provided. One thing to note - you do share a bed, so if you are booking only 1 ticket you will share with a stranger. We booked 2 tickets as we are a couple. We are 5 ft 7 and 5 ft 9, regular build and it was very cosy width ways and definitely not long enough (the beds are obviously designed for a petite person). It is bearable for 1 night but I wouldn't expect to sleep much. Also, with the the road from Vientiane to Pakse being the main road running through the country, you would expect it to be semi decent but it was very bumpy.

E G
The bus is really confy, clean and seems pretty new. The AC was strong but bearable The blankets were clean, soft and didn't smell bad. The toilets were a little bit smelly but clean. The driver was driving like crazy and we arrived at Vientiane 1h early. We didn't stop in a gas station or wathever so use the toilets on board if you need and brig food with you (they provide a small snack and a small bottle of water). The departure is at 8:30pm (on the ticket) not 8pm. On the website the price if a lot more than the one on the ticket. The normal price is 170000 kip so book directly at the bus station, at least 1h30 before the departure.
